.elementor-2595 .elementor-element.elementor-element-db72683{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:48px 48px;--row-gap:48px;--column-gap:48px;}.elementor-2595 .elementor-element.elementor-element-db72683:not(.elementor-motion-effects-element-type-background), .elementor-2595 .elementor-element.elementor-element-db72683 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-81c87db );background-image:url("/wp-content/uploads/2026/01/element-bg.jpg");background-position:center center;background-repeat:no-repeat;background-size:cover;}.elementor-2595 .elementor-element.elementor-element-4a40e62{--display:flex;--gap:32px 32px;--row-gap:32px;--column-gap:32px;}.elementor-2595 .elementor-element.elementor-element-db7f2e4{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:48px 48px;--row-gap:48px;--column-gap:48px;--padding-top:48px;--padding-bottom:48px;--padding-left:48px;--padding-right:48px;}.elementor-2595 .elementor-element.elementor-element-f1f031c{--display:flex;--justify-content:center;--gap:16px 16px;--row-gap:16px;--column-gap:16px;}.elementor-2595 .elementor-element.elementor-element-f1f031c.e-con{--flex-grow:1;--flex-shrink:0;}.elementor-2595 .elementor-element.elementor-element-ea60b88 .elementor-heading-title{font-family:var( --e-global-typography-2c57697-font-family ), Sans-serif;font-size:var( --e-global-typography-2c57697-font-size );font-weight:var( --e-global-typography-2c57697-font-weight );line-height:var( --e-global-typography-2c57697-line-height );color:var( --e-global-color-18a538c );}.elementor-2595 .elementor-element.elementor-element-77199d5{--display:flex;}.elementor-2595 .elementor-element.elementor-element-ee64caf .elementor-heading-title{font-size:var( --e-global-typography-c0bbca5-font-size );font-weight:var( --e-global-typography-c0bbca5-font-weight );line-height:var( --e-global-typography-c0bbca5-line-height );color:var( --e-global-color-18a538c );}.elementor-2595 .elementor-element.elementor-element-c1d9ba9 .elementor-heading-title{color:var( --e-global-color-18a538c );}.elementor-2595 .elementor-element.elementor-element-d72b8c7{--display:flex;--min-height:262px;--overflow:hidden;}.elementor-2595 .elementor-element.elementor-element-d72b8c7:not(.elementor-motion-effects-element-type-background), .elementor-2595 .elementor-element.elementor-element-d72b8c7 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-81c87db );}.elementor-2595 .elementor-element.elementor-element-d72b8c7.e-con{--flex-grow:1;--flex-shrink:0;}.elementor-2595 .elementor-element.elementor-element-c9ee586{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:48px 48px;--row-gap:48px;--column-gap:48px;--padding-top:48px;--padding-bottom:48px;--padding-left:48px;--padding-right:48px;}.elementor-2595 .elementor-element.elementor-element-5bb23df{--display:flex;--min-height:262px;--overflow:hidden;}.elementor-2595 .elementor-element.elementor-element-5bb23df:not(.elementor-motion-effects-element-type-background), .elementor-2595 .elementor-element.elementor-element-5bb23df >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-81c87db );}.elementor-2595 .elementor-element.elementor-element-5bb23df.e-con{--flex-grow:1;--flex-shrink:0;}.elementor-2595 .elementor-element.elementor-element-47a2c36{--display:flex;--justify-content:center;--gap:16px 16px;--row-gap:16px;--column-gap:16px;}.elementor-2595 .elementor-element.elementor-element-47a2c36.e-con{--flex-grow:1;--flex-shrink:0;}.elementor-2595 .elementor-element.elementor-element-a5da6a5 .elementor-heading-title{font-family:var( --e-global-typography-2c57697-font-family ), Sans-serif;font-size:var( --e-global-typography-2c57697-font-size );font-weight:var( --e-global-typography-2c57697-font-weight );line-height:var( --e-global-typography-2c57697-line-height );color:var( --e-global-color-18a538c );}.elementor-2595 .elementor-element.elementor-element-fb08f23{--display:flex;}.elementor-2595 .elementor-element.elementor-element-91d7399 .elementor-heading-title{font-size:var( --e-global-typography-c0bbca5-font-size );font-weight:var( --e-global-typography-c0bbca5-font-weight );line-height:var( --e-global-typography-c0bbca5-line-height );color:var( --e-global-color-18a538c );}.elementor-2595 .elementor-element.elementor-element-33fb44b .elementor-heading-title{color:var( --e-global-color-18a538c );}.elementor-2595 .elementor-element.elementor-element-9433b26{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:48px 48px;--row-gap:48px;--column-gap:48px;--padding-top:48px;--padding-bottom:48px;--padding-left:48px;--padding-right:48px;}.elementor-2595 .elementor-element.elementor-element-c9c4d2f{--display:flex;--justify-content:center;--gap:16px 16px;--row-gap:16px;--column-gap:16px;}.elementor-2595 .elementor-element.elementor-element-c9c4d2f.e-con{--flex-grow:1;--flex-shrink:0;}.elementor-2595 .elementor-element.elementor-element-1370469 .elementor-heading-title{font-family:var( --e-global-typography-2c57697-font-family ), Sans-serif;font-size:var( --e-global-typography-2c57697-font-size );font-weight:var( --e-global-typography-2c57697-font-weight );line-height:var( --e-global-typography-2c57697-line-height );color:var( --e-global-color-18a538c );}.elementor-2595 .elementor-element.elementor-element-056cf9b{--display:flex;}.elementor-2595 .elementor-element.elementor-element-092fe83 .elementor-heading-title{font-size:var( --e-global-typography-c0bbca5-font-size );font-weight:var( --e-global-typography-c0bbca5-font-weight );line-height:var( --e-global-typography-c0bbca5-line-height );color:var( --e-global-color-18a538c );}.elementor-2595 .elementor-element.elementor-element-5684deb .elementor-heading-title{color:var( --e-global-color-18a538c );}.elementor-2595 .elementor-element.elementor-element-eba6c56{--display:flex;--min-height:262px;--overflow:hidden;}.elementor-2595 .elementor-element.elementor-element-eba6c56:not(.elementor-motion-effects-element-type-background), .elementor-2595 .elementor-element.elementor-element-eba6c56 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-81c87db );}.elementor-2595 .elementor-element.elementor-element-eba6c56.e-con{--flex-grow:1;--flex-shrink:0;}@media(max-width:810px){.elementor-2595 .elementor-element.elementor-element-db7f2e4{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-2595 .elementor-element.elementor-element-ea60b88 .elementor-heading-title{font-size:var( --e-global-typography-2c57697-font-size );line-height:var( --e-global-typography-2c57697-line-height );}.elementor-2595 .elementor-element.elementor-element-ee64caf .elementor-heading-title{font-size:var( --e-global-typography-c0bbca5-font-size );line-height:var( --e-global-typography-c0bbca5-line-height );}.elementor-2595 .elementor-element.elementor-element-c9ee586{--flex-direction:column-reverse;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-2595 .elementor-element.elementor-element-a5da6a5 .elementor-heading-title{font-size:var( --e-global-typography-2c57697-font-size );line-height:var( --e-global-typography-2c57697-line-height );}.elementor-2595 .elementor-element.elementor-element-91d7399 .elementor-heading-title{font-size:var( --e-global-typography-c0bbca5-font-size );line-height:var( --e-global-typography-c0bbca5-line-height );}.elementor-2595 .elementor-element.elementor-element-9433b26{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-2595 .elementor-element.elementor-element-1370469 .elementor-heading-title{font-size:var( --e-global-typography-2c57697-font-size );line-height:var( --e-global-typography-2c57697-line-height );}.elementor-2595 .elementor-element.elementor-element-092fe83 .elementor-heading-title{font-size:var( --e-global-typography-c0bbca5-font-size );line-height:var( --e-global-typography-c0bbca5-line-height );}}@media(max-width:767px){.elementor-2595 .elementor-element.elementor-element-db7f2e4{--padding-top:24px;--padding-bottom:24px;--padding-left:24px;--padding-right:24px;}.elementor-2595 .elementor-element.elementor-element-ea60b88 .elementor-heading-title{font-size:var( --e-global-typography-2c57697-font-size );line-height:var( --e-global-typography-2c57697-line-height );}.elementor-2595 .elementor-element.elementor-element-ee64caf .elementor-heading-title{font-size:var( --e-global-typography-c0bbca5-font-size );line-height:var( --e-global-typography-c0bbca5-line-height );}.elementor-2595 .elementor-element.elementor-element-c9ee586{--padding-top:24px;--padding-bottom:24px;--padding-left:24px;--padding-right:24px;}.elementor-2595 .elementor-element.elementor-element-a5da6a5 .elementor-heading-title{font-size:var( --e-global-typography-2c57697-font-size );line-height:var( --e-global-typography-2c57697-line-height );}.elementor-2595 .elementor-element.elementor-element-91d7399 .elementor-heading-title{font-size:var( --e-global-typography-c0bbca5-font-size );line-height:var( --e-global-typography-c0bbca5-line-height );}.elementor-2595 .elementor-element.elementor-element-9433b26{--padding-top:24px;--padding-bottom:24px;--padding-left:24px;--padding-right:24px;}.elementor-2595 .elementor-element.elementor-element-1370469 .elementor-heading-title{font-size:var( --e-global-typography-2c57697-font-size );line-height:var( --e-global-typography-2c57697-line-height );}.elementor-2595 .elementor-element.elementor-element-092fe83 .elementor-heading-title{font-size:var( --e-global-typography-c0bbca5-font-size );line-height:var( --e-global-typography-c0bbca5-line-height );}}@media(min-width:768px){.elementor-2595 .elementor-element.elementor-element-f1f031c{--width:25%;}.elementor-2595 .elementor-element.elementor-element-d72b8c7{--width:25%;}.elementor-2595 .elementor-element.elementor-element-5bb23df{--width:25%;}.elementor-2595 .elementor-element.elementor-element-47a2c36{--width:25%;}.elementor-2595 .elementor-element.elementor-element-c9c4d2f{--width:25%;}.elementor-2595 .elementor-element.elementor-element-eba6c56{--width:25%;}}@media(max-width:810px) and (min-width:768px){.elementor-2595 .elementor-element.elementor-element-f1f031c{--width:100%;}.elementor-2595 .elementor-element.elementor-element-d72b8c7{--width:100%;}.elementor-2595 .elementor-element.elementor-element-5bb23df{--width:100%;}.elementor-2595 .elementor-element.elementor-element-47a2c36{--width:100%;}.elementor-2595 .elementor-element.elementor-element-c9c4d2f{--width:100%;}.elementor-2595 .elementor-element.elementor-element-eba6c56{--width:100%;}}/* Start custom CSS for heading, class: .elementor-element-ea60b88 */.elementor-2595 .elementor-element.elementor-element-ea60b88 {
    border-radius: 999px;
    border: 1px solid var(--border-text-light, #FAFAFA);

    /* Shadows/shadow-xs-skeuomorphic */
    box-shadow: 0 0 0 1px var(--Colors-Effects-Shadows-shadow-skeumorphic-inner-border, rgba(10, 13, 18, 0.18)) inset, 0 -2px 0 0 var(--Colors-Effects-Shadows-shadow-skeumorphic-inner, rgba(10, 13, 18, 0.05)) inset, 0 1px 2px 0 var(--Colors-Effects-Shadows-shadow-xs, rgba(10, 13, 18, 0.05));
    display: flex;
    width: 60px;
    height: 60px;
    padding: 10px 21px;
    justify-content: center;
    align-items: center;
    aspect-ratio: 1/1;
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-d72b8c7 */.elementor-2595 .elementor-element.elementor-element-d72b8c7 {
    border-radius: var(--radius-size-tiny, 14px);
    border: var(--border-size-border-thin, 1px) solid var(--Colors-Tertiary-100, #E2E8EB);
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-db7f2e4 */.elementor-2595 .elementor-element.elementor-element-db7f2e4 {
    border-radius: var(--radius-size-small, 18px);
    background: var(--colors-primary-500, #5C6D5D);
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-5bb23df */.elementor-2595 .elementor-element.elementor-element-5bb23df {
    border-radius: var(--radius-size-tiny, 14px);
    border: var(--border-size-border-thin, 1px) solid var(--Colors-Tertiary-100, #E2E8EB);
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-a5da6a5 */.elementor-2595 .elementor-element.elementor-element-a5da6a5 {
    border-radius: 999px;
    border: 1px solid var(--border-text-light, #FAFAFA);

    /* Shadows/shadow-xs-skeuomorphic */
    box-shadow: 0 0 0 1px var(--Colors-Effects-Shadows-shadow-skeumorphic-inner-border, rgba(10, 13, 18, 0.18)) inset, 0 -2px 0 0 var(--Colors-Effects-Shadows-shadow-skeumorphic-inner, rgba(10, 13, 18, 0.05)) inset, 0 1px 2px 0 var(--Colors-Effects-Shadows-shadow-xs, rgba(10, 13, 18, 0.05));
    display: flex;
    width: 60px;
    height: 60px;
    padding: 10px 21px;
    justify-content: center;
    align-items: center;
    aspect-ratio: 1/1;
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-c9ee586 */.elementor-2595 .elementor-element.elementor-element-c9ee586 {
    border-radius: var(--radius-size-small, 18px);
    background: var(--colors-tertiary-600, #4C5F6B);
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-1370469 */.elementor-2595 .elementor-element.elementor-element-1370469 {
    border-radius: 999px;
    border: 1px solid var(--border-text-light, #FAFAFA);

    /* Shadows/shadow-xs-skeuomorphic */
    box-shadow: 0 0 0 1px var(--Colors-Effects-Shadows-shadow-skeumorphic-inner-border, rgba(10, 13, 18, 0.18)) inset, 0 -2px 0 0 var(--Colors-Effects-Shadows-shadow-skeumorphic-inner, rgba(10, 13, 18, 0.05)) inset, 0 1px 2px 0 var(--Colors-Effects-Shadows-shadow-xs, rgba(10, 13, 18, 0.05));
    display: flex;
    width: 60px;
    height: 60px;
    padding: 10px 21px;
    justify-content: center;
    align-items: center;
    aspect-ratio: 1/1;
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-eba6c56 */.elementor-2595 .elementor-element.elementor-element-eba6c56 {
    border-radius: var(--radius-size-tiny, 14px);
    border: var(--border-size-border-thin, 1px) solid var(--Colors-Tertiary-100, #E2E8EB);
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-9433b26 */.elementor-2595 .elementor-element.elementor-element-9433b26 {
    border-radius: var(--radius-size-small, 18px);
    background: var(--Colors-Accent-600, #908366);
}/* End custom CSS */